Ronaldo targets new record

Portugal national football team and FC Real Madrid (Spain) striker Cristiano Ronaldo can set a new record for goals scored in a UEFA Champions League group stage when Real Madrid visit FC Copenhagen (Denmark) on Tuesday, FIFA official website reports. 

The 28-year-old Portuguese has found the net eight times in just four European appearances this season to equal the record jointly held by Ruud Van Nistelrooy (Holland), Filippo Inzaghi (Italy), Hernán Crespo (Argentina) and Zlatan Ibrahimović (Sweden), who has also scored eight times for Paris Saint-Germain (PSG; France) this season. But Ibrahimović will not be playing in PSG’s Champions League group match against S.L. Benfica (Portugal).    

 The Real Madrid-Copenhagen game will kick off at 11։45pm, Armenia time.
